About Sr. Naval Electrical Engineer

  Position Description

  Serco is seeking a full-time Electrical Engineer IV to support the Naval Oceanographic Office (NAVO) at John C. Stennis Space Center in South Mississippi by providing expertise in areas of design, modification, repair, testing, and trial support of oceanographic data collection assets.

  This position is contingent upon your ability to obtain/maintain/transfer your Secret clearance (U.S. citizenship is required).

  As an Electrical Engineer, you will support design and modification of electrical components for various oceanographic data collection assets as well as develop machinery to insert or extract assets from operational and test environments. You will apply electronics expertise and engineering principles to design instruments, controls, and equipment supporting deployable systems in various labs, on ships and ocean vessels, and in saltwater environments. You will conduct product testing and create models, and interface with component vendors to ensure mission requirements are met.

  In this role, you will :

  Develop and analyze system and electrical designs, specifications, and technical data to prepare various systems are ready for developmental/operational testing.

  Create, modify, and use electrical drawings, schematics, and associated software and tools to manage design configurations.

  Analyze results from data collection systems and capabilities under test/evaluation to ensure performance successfully meets engineering specifications and operational requirements.

  Investigate system failures, evaluate corrective alternatives, and implement actions to ensure systems maintain safe, effective operations and minimize/eliminate potential future system failures.

  Work within technical support teams to meet field mission requirements and resolve technical issues.

  Formulate methods and processes which will increase operational effectiveness, safety, efficiency, and readiness.

  Perform platform and payload upgrades as requested by the Govt. customer.

  Travel as needed to meet customer needs.

  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department.

  Perform additional duties and responsibilities as assigned by Serco Management and Govt. customers.

  Qualifications

  To be successful in this role, you will have:

  Master’s Degree in an engineering discipline plus 8-10 years of relevant work experience.

  Must be able to obtain / maintain an active SECRET level clearance. (U.S. Citizenship is required)

  Knowledge of electrical principles, methods, and techniques within a specific area of expertise.

  Knowledge of relevant tools, equipment, hardware, and engineering design software.

  Must be able to support emergent travel as required for up to 10% of time annually.

  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

  Strong communication and interpersonal skills.

  Excellent customer service skills.

  Familiarity with Navy research and development concepts, practices, procedures, and testing.

  Familiarity with Microsoft programs (Word, Excel, Outlook, etc.).

  Proficient in Microsoft Office suite programs, MS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
